Cable gauge

Lo-Z and 70 / 100 V

Maximum run by conductor size

Published maximum lengths, for less than 0.5 dB of loss on a low-impedance run and less than 1.0 dB on a constant-voltage run of 20 evenly distributed speakers. Hi-Z lengths should not exceed 250 m in any case.

Lo-Z · 0.5 dB loss
mm² AWG 4 Ω 8 Ω
0.75≈185 m10 m
1.5≈1610 m20 m
2.5≈1417 m35 m
4.0≈1228 m55 m
70 V · 1.0 dB loss · 20 speakers
mm² AWG 125 W/ch 250 W/ch
0.75≈1890 m45 m
1.5≈16180 m90 m
2.0≈14< 250 m150 m
3.5≈12< 250 m< 250 m
100 V · 1.0 dB loss · 20 speakers
mm² AWG 125 W/ch 250 W/ch
0.75≈18190 m90 m
1.5≈16< 250 m180 m
2.0≈14< 250 m< 250 m
3.5≈12< 250 m< 250 m
On site Order of operations

Commissioning, in the order it is meant to happen

The interim version of the configuration walkthrough: the sequence an installer works through, with the detail behind each step linked rather than repeated.

Steps four to six follow the manufacturer's own recommended order for configuring the amplifier — inputs, then zones and routing, then outputs. Working it in that order matters, because each stage is what the next one has to assign.

Set-up happens over the amplifier's own network or the building's, in a browser, with nothing to install on the laptop you brought. What the interface contains is on the technology page.

  1. Rack it, with the clearances. Ventilation apertures sit on the sides and the rear panel and the unit is fan-cooled — the published free-air figures are on the technology page, and they are easier to honour before the rack is full than after.
  2. Make every connection before mains. There is no power switch: the amplifier is operational the moment mains is connected. Signal, speaker, GPIO and network connections all belong to the unpowered unit. It is a Class I product and needs an earthed mains cable.
  3. Power up and read the front panel. Status, Network and WiFi tell you where the amplifier has got to before you have opened anything. What each indicator reports is documented on the product page.
  4. Connect and open the interface. Either join the amplifier's own wireless access point, or reach it over the building network on the rear-panel Ethernet socket. The configuration interface is served by the amplifier itself to any browser.
  5. Inputs, then zones, then outputs. Set input sensitivity and gain; assign inputs to zones and zones to outputs; set each output's mode — low impedance or 70/100 V — and its processing. Power Share needs no step of its own: sharing across each pair is automatic.
  6. Set a password, then check the firmware. The interface can hold its own password, which is worth setting on any amplifier reachable from a wired network. Check the installed firmware version while you are there — see below.
  7. Back up the configuration before you leave. A configuration can be exported to a file and restored onto the same unit or another one. On a multi-amplifier install that is the difference between a repeatable system and a retyped one, and it is what makes a service call cheap.
Firmware V1.8.0

Checked and updated by the amplifier itself

The documentation on this site describes firmware V1.8.0. The version installed in a given unit is shown in its own configuration interface, under the device options in the Settings tab, and it is updated from the same place.

The manufacturer's guidance is worth following literally: check the installed version when the amplifier is commissioned, check it regularly after that, and if a newer version is available, treat the update as a priority rather than as maintenance to get to eventually.
